On Tue, Sep 29, 2015 at 07:06:31PM +0900, Chanwoo Choi wrote: > This patch reorders the default statement to remove unnecessary warning > message > when info->hpdet_ip_version is 2.
Should say is higher than 2. > > Signed-off-by: Chanwoo Choi <[email protected]> > --- But otherwise looks fine, the intention I imagine was to print a warning for unknown hpdep ip but still handle it as ip version 2. But given that the ip can only be unknown if there has been a mistake coding the driver return EINVAL seems fine too.
